known faces and spin-offs

Among the celebrities who were aware of the series can be found names like Konny Reimann, who documented his new life in Hawaii extremely successfully and even received his own spin-off. Daniela Katzenberger, who became a star through “Goodbye Germany” and other formats, and the unfortunately deceased Jens Büchner, whose life and fate touched many, are also the illustrious round of the emigrants. Jannine Weigel, a pop star from Thailand, and Steff Jerkel from Hawaii also shared their stories on the platform.

The series not only received recognition in Germany, but was even nominated for the German TV Award in 2011. The 15th anniversary of the show was celebrated in 2021 with a podcast on RTL+. In addition, the concept of the program has developed further by producing several spin-offs since 2022, including "Goodbye Germany! The greatest adventures in the world".
